Towards the Adoption of Data Management Systems by Quantity Surveyors

Data management is a crucial and useful tool for construction companies due to its ability to aid business management. Data management plays an important role to construction of professionals, including quantity surveying (QS). Despite the milestones achieved within the construction industry, the QS profession faced some challenges in its upbringing. QS is an essential profession within the construction industry and requires its personnel to be exposed to and continuously involved in technologies. Thus, this study evaluated factors affecting the adoption of data management towards QS practice. The methodology of this study was conducted in three phases: literature review, data collection (via questionnaires), and data analysis. This study adopted the random sampling technique. The data was collected from quantity surveyors through questionnaires within the study area (Gauteng Province, South Africa). Furthermore, the collected data was analyzed using SPSS V 28 and presented using the mean score, frequency distribution, and principal component analysis. The mean item score of this study revealed that accessibility, efficiency, and reliability were ranked as the top three factors influencing adoption. Furthermore, this study presented factors affecting the adoption of data management towards QS, including project cost, schedule, and performance, to mention a few. The variable factors affecting the adoption of data management were grouped into different categories through the principal component analysis. The study presented factors of data management towards QS and displayed the solution to the factors affecting the adoption of data management. Articles related to the factors of data management were reviewed extensively and information was collected, however, not enough solutions for the adoption were presented.
